                                First of all, nice analogy, despite it leaving you wide open to Sanecow's riposte.

                                Mick is as good a full forward as we need. He has played 55 games over the past three years in that position and kicked 131 goals - an average of about 2.4 a game despite the fact that he is our second choice target! He stands 189cm tall, is a fine mark and has excellent ground skills. I'm not sure what more you're asking for.

                                As for Leo, well, he has made AA twice in the past two years. I agree that he's suspect against the gorillas, but the sheer fact is that there isn't a whole lot of options on the market. Mal Michael *might* be one, but he is 29, his body is battered and he's shown a liking for dollars. The truth is that whether Leo makes the car look nice and shiny or not, the car goes very well. We weren't the second best defence in the league this year for no good reason.

                                There is some concern that the physical demands of full back may force Leo into early retirement. We're yet to see that logic substantiated by fact - he's missed something like two games since returning from his freak ruptured spleen in mid 2002. I realise that he's thirty in a year and a half, and we need to plan ahead. That's why promoting Grundy, giving him a taste and drafting a mature tall like Podsiadly is a good idea.

                                I have to admit to being a little stumped as to what our car's problems are. Sure, it might not look like a Ferrari, but it just beat the Ferraris and won the race.
